QUALIFICATION & PRE-CERTIFICATION VETERANS INITIATIVE NEW PROGRAM IN PROJECT MANAGEMENT AND INFORMATION TECHNOLOGY TRAINING This program provides a scholarship to a two-semester, six month, Certificate in Project Management training program offered by Western Connecticut State University (WCSU), as well as full-time employment in either Hartford, CT or Shelton, CT. This is a work-study program—the participants will initially attend the training for a Certificate in Project Management from WCSU. Upon successful completion of that program, candidates will continue working full time for Workforce Opportunity Services (WOS), the non-profit organization that operates the work-study program, as a consultant to the sponsoring company. Once working at the sponsor site, participants will receive additional project management training working on projects with an IT focus. Participants who earn their certificate from WCSU, and are successful as a Project Manager during the work portion of the program can be hired by the sponsoring company. Veterans accepted into the training program will receive a stipend throughout the six-month period. There is no cost to participate in any portion of this program. To participate in this program, candidates must have the following qualifications: Military Service past 9/11/2001 (Active Duty, Reserve, Guard) Honorable Discharge High school diploma or equivalent Upon acceptance you will initially attend classes in project management two evenings per week and then participate in practical work experience.
